#560ea8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#560ea8 is composed of 33.7% red, 5.5%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.8% cyan, 91.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 268.1 degrees, a saturation of 84.6% and a lightness of 35.7%. #560ea8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ac1cff with #000051.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

Shades and Tints of #560ea8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030005 is the darkest color, while #f8f2fe is the lightest one.
